About

Kathryn Falb is a scholar working on Health, General Health Professions and Clinical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Kathryn Falb has authored 79 papers receiving a total of 1.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 55 papers in Health, 41 papers in General Health Professions and 36 papers in Clinical Psychology. Recurrent topics in Kathryn Falb's work include Intimate Partner and Family Violence (55 papers), Adolescent Sexual and Reproductive Health (29 papers) and Migration, Health and Trauma (26 papers). Kathryn Falb is often cited by papers focused on Intimate Partner and Family Violence (55 papers), Adolescent Sexual and Reproductive Health (29 papers) and Migration, Health and Trauma (26 papers). Kathryn Falb collaborates with scholars based in United States, Ethiopia and United Kingdom. Kathryn Falb's co-authors include Jhumka Gupta, Jeannie Annan, Denise Kpébo, Lindsay Stark, Khudejha Asghar, Mazeda Hossain, Jay G. Silverman, Gary Yu, Ziming Xuan and Heather L. McCauley and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and PLoS ONE.
